摘要
PURPOSE: To disperse wooden dust uniformly by limiting a moisture content within a range of a specific wt.% or less, then mixing a specific wt.% range of a thermoplastic resin molding material with a specific range of wt.% of crushed cellulose material with a specific average particulate diameter, then kneading the mixture for gelation and lyophilzing the gel and finaly finelly crushing it within a specific particulate range. ;CONSTITUTION: In order to reduce the friction drag of wooden dust at the time of kneading for gelation, the wooden dust is made granular or pulverized ranging from an average particulate diameter of 5 to 15. Further, a pyroligneous acid gas generated at the time of gelation kneading and molding is dispersed by evaporation and the generation of vapor or bubbles is minimized. Further, the moisture content is limited within a range of 15wt.% or less so that the surface of a molding is prevented from becoming roughened. A crushed cellulose material such as wooden dust which is equal to 20 to 75wt.% of the total amount of raw material used for the manufacture of fine particulate wooden synthetic powder, is mixed with the 25 to 80wt.% of thermoplastic resin molding material. This mixture is kneaded for gelation, and the gel is lyophilized to be finely crushed to a granular diameter of 1 to 8.;COPYRIGHT: (C)1996,JPO
